Transaction 38b2cae820ceb33cbcb44fa78668aa43fb2acb3da834632e80b7e78d522ca906

1 Input
2 Outputs
  • 38b2cae820ceb33cbcb44fa78668aa43fb2acb3da834632e80b7e78d522ca906:0
  • value  4186910
    address  1KwuRHhXHUR8VFn7rPnXbsJmk5vfX9hCtA
  • 38b2cae820ceb33cbcb44fa78668aa43fb2acb3da834632e80b7e78d522ca906:1
  • value  2444822
    address  18cqp1o6WBLMHCTVaNmHRnc5o811apae1d